Small sugar falls on lower demand

Small sugar fell further at the Vashi wholesale market here today on continuous selling pressure amid lower demand from millers and bulk consumers.
However, medium sugar ruled stable in the absence of any worthwhile buying.
Small sugar prices (S-30) dipped by Rs 25/10 per quintal to Rs 2,135/2,242 from saturday's closing level of Rs 2,160/2,252.
Medium sugar (M-30) was quoted at Rs 2,280/2,502 per quintal.
Following are today's closing rates for sugar (per quintal) with the previous rates given in brackets:
Small sugar (S-30) quality: Rs 2,135/2,242 (Rs 2,160/2,252).
Medium sugar (M-30) quality: Rs 2,280/2,502 (Rs 2,280/2,502).
